    CBRE Group, Inc. is the world’s largest commercial real estate services and investment firm (based on 2021 revenues) with more than 100,000 employees (excluding Turner & Townsend). CBRE has been included in the Fortune 500 since 2008, ranking #126 in 2022. It also has been voted the industry’s top brand by the Lipsey Company for 20 consecutive years, named one of Fortune’s “Most Admired Companies” in the real estate sector for twelve years in a row, and recognized for environmental sustainability activities through inclusion in the Dow Jones World Sustainability Index. Its shares trade on the New York Stock Exchange under the symbol “CBRE”. 

    The company provides real estate investors and occupiers with an integrated suite of services, including facilities, transaction and project management; property management; investment management; appraisal and valuation; property leasing; strategic consulting; property sales; mortgage services and development services.

    Some of the potential opportunities are:

    • FINANCIAL PLANNING & ANALYSIS (FP&A) - Leverages knowledge and functional expertise to deliver consistent, world class budgeting, forecasting, and long-term planning and analysis support.

    • BUSINESS PARTNERSHIP - Aligns Segment Finance around CBRE’s business and go-to-market strategy by providing consistent, world-class decision-making support.

    • FINANCE PROCESSES - Establishes the governance around process standardization, compliance and innovation.

    • FINANCE INNOVATION OFFICE (FIO) - Provides support for transformational initiatives which strategically combine people, process, technology, and data changes to provide improvements in overall performance.

    • CONTROLLERSHIP - Ensures the completeness and accuracy of the firm’s financial and regulatory reporting. Controllership leverages an analytical mindset and internal controls focus for business strategy and decision making.

    • TREASURY - Refines and improves CBRE’s global cash management by driving automation and standardization projects to create operational efficiencies.

    • TAX - Improves the tax efficiency of CBRE's operations and optimizes the tax results of acquisitions, divestitures, and reorganizations while ensuring that tax filing and payment obligations are met, and tax activity is accurately reflected in financial reports.
